The watt is a unit of power, measuring the energy the bulb uses each second. The wattage is often printed directly on the bulb as a number followed by a w. If you don't see it there, check the packaging the bulb was sold in. In the case of our default, the appliance uses 75 watts of power. To put that into perspective, a modern led bulb only uses around 10 watts of power to produce the same amount of light. Traditional incandescent bulbs use 25 to 100.
